Iron Ladle Castable is made of high quality baxuite chamotte, silicon carbide, superfine powder, binder and admixture.
Designed for demanding molten iron transportation conditions, our Iron Ladle Refractory Castable provides strong resistance to molten iron erosion, slag attack, thermal cycling and mechanical scouring.
GUOLIANG supplies TBJ-1, TBJ-2 and TBJ-3 grades and can recommend suitable castable solutions according to ladle capacity, operating temperature, lining structure and required service life.

TECHNICAL SPECIFICATIONS
| Index | TBJ-1 | TBJ-2 | TBJ-3 |
| Al2O3+SiC % ≥ | 65 | 60 | 55 |
| Bulk density g/cm3 ≥110℃ | 2.45 | 2.30 | 2.20 |
| CCS MPa ≥110℃ | 25 | 20 | 20 |
| CCS MPa ≥1000℃ | 40 | 30 | 25 |
| CCS MPa ≥1450℃ | 35 | 35 | 30 |
| Linear change after heating %1450℃ | ±0.5 | ±0.8 | ±1.0 |

Both products are used in iron ladle refractory systems, but their installation methods and lining characteristics are different.
| Factor | Iron Ladle Castable | Iron Ladle Brick |
| Type | Monolithic refractory | Shaped refractory |
| Installation | Casting / monolithic installation | Brick masonry |
| Joints | Fewer lining joints | Contains brick joints |
| Shape adaptability | High | Depends on brick shape |
| Local repair | Convenient | Individual bricks may require replacement |
| Typical use | Permanent lining, repair, monolithic lining | Working lining and zoned masonry |
Iron Ladle Castable is advantageous where monolithic installation, shape adaptability and repair flexibility are required.
Iron Ladle Brick, including Al₂O₃-SiC-C bricks, can be selected where shaped refractory masonry and controlled zone lining are preferred.
The best solution depends on ladle structure, operating conditions and maintenance strategy.
